About the
Role:
Are you a people person with a passion for sales and customer service? We are looking for a motivated and energetic Leasing Consultant to join our multi-family property team. As the first point of contact for prospective residents, you'll play a key role in creating a positive leasing experience and maintaining high occupancy.
Responsibilities:
Greet prospective residents and provide tours of the property Respond promptly to leasing inquiries via phone, email, and in person Promote the community through marketing and outreach efforts Process applications and lease documents accurately and efficiently Maintain up-to-date knowledge of apartment availability, pricing, and lease terms Follow up with prospects and maintain strong communication throughout the leasing process Assist with resident retention and community events Work collaboratively with the property management and maintenance teams
Qualifications:
1+ year of leasing, sales, or customer service experience (preferred) Excellent communication and interpersonal skills Strong organizational and time management abilities Familiarity with property management software (e.g., Yardi and RentCafe) a plus High school diploma or equivalent required Ability to work weekends and a flexible schedule as needed Benefits Competitive hourly pay Medical benefits package with options Paid time off and holidays - The best PTO package in the industry!
